Sunday, August 25, 2013. South Dakota. The Black Hills. One phrase that comes to my mind when I think of that beautiful landscape is “picked over.”. The Black Hills have been picked over by miners, loggers, gem hunters, rock thieves, bikers, hikers – and me. Over two million visitors a year swarm over the hills. European Americans began flocking to the area from the mid-19. Century onward in search of gold and timber. Street reminds me vaguely of the pines for which the Black Hills are named. It’s ...
